基于MySQL的高可靠性缓存DNS系统的设计与实现  被引量:2

Design and Realization of High-reliability Cache DNS System Based on Mysql

在线阅读下载全文

作  者:宋国柱[1] 杨华[1] 车秀梅[1] 

机构地区:[1]山西农业大学网络中心,山西太谷030801

出  处:《太原科技大学学报》2014年第6期423-428,共6页Journal of Taiyuan University of Science and Technology

摘  要:为提高DNS服务的响应时间,在分析DNS查询日志的基础上,提出了基于My SQL数据库的高可靠性缓存DNS系统,设计了该系统的框架结构,并在bind源代码的基础上使用C语言实现了该系统。通过大量域名对该系统进行压力测试表明,将DNS缓存存储于My SQL数据库相比传统DNS系统,在RTT max、RTT min、RTT average、Ran for、查询命中率和查询请求等方面都具有突出的性能,可大大改善DNS服务的响应时间。In order to improve the responsive time of DNS,based on analyzing query log of DNS,this study puts for-ward the highly reliable cache DNS system originating from MySQL database,designs its frame and realizes this sys-tem by using C language on the basis of bind source code. With the pressure of this system tested by a large number of domain names and comparing cache DNS system with traditional DNS system,it can be concluded that this sys-tem plays a proficient role in RRT max,RRT min ,RTT average,RAN for and query accuracy and request,eventu-ally greatly changes the responsive time of DNS.

关 键 词:DNS MySQL缓存 BIND 

分 类 号:TP393.07[自动化与计算机技术—计算机应用技术]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象